As Manchester’s DUDS get set to hit the road with their new album ImmediateGetintothis’ Jane Davies brings news of a Shipping Forecast date.

DUDS will play Liverpool’s Shipping Forecast on Wednesday November 7 as part of a UK tour.

Back in January they cooked up a real storm at the Bagelry, suitably impressing our man on the scene with their relentlessly infectious and oddly addictive compositions of bite-sized post punk goodness.

Straddling the twin worlds of art rock and post punk the band draw inspiration from Fire Engines, A Certain Ratio and Devo, becoming the first UK-based band to find a home on John Dwyer‘s Castle Face label.

Since their formation in 2015, the line up has grown from four band members to seven with all those extra hands allowing for additional experimentation as well as the added dimensions of a brass section and even cow bells!

With their expanded formation it’s certainly going to be a tight squeeze onstage in the intimate confines of the Shipping Forecast for a band whose early career highlights has seen them provide support to the likes of Gang of Four, The Raincoats and Omni.

Back in May they toured France, Spain and Portugal and this summer has seen appearances at a plethora of festivals including Clamlines, Visions and Green Man.

Come down to the Shipping Forecast on November 7 to see and hear something completely different but with a retro feel.

Apparently their stage outfits are grey shirts with epaulettes, making them look like musical parcel delivery men. It’s certain they are going to deliver a lively set!
